Director Of Data & Ai Culture
The Director of Data & AI Culture will play a pivotal role in shaping, embedding, and scaling a data-driven and AI-empowered culture across our global organization. This leader will act as a change catalyst, ensuring employees at all levels treat data as a strategic asset (valued, trusted, accessible and used to drive business decisions) and embrace innovative and ethical adoption of AI.
